Bellmore-Merrick Bowling Named County Champs

020619_bowl.jpg thumbnail117214
The Bellmore-Merrick boys bowling team won the Nassau County Championships at AMF Garden City Lanes on Feb 2. 

The team is coached by Joseph Bianca, who is also a special education teacher at Sanford H. Calhoun High School.

“We had a strong core group of five boys who bowled 24 games over the season,” he said. “But senior leadership was a key for the title.”

Lead by three-time All-County bowler Sam Farber, two-time All-County bowler Nick Breidenback and one-time All-County bowler Donovan Moran, the team also saw strong performances by junior James Petter and freshman Brendan Moran. 

They move on to compete at the New York State championships on March 7-8.
